Does AI-enhanced coronary sinus flow MRI with exercise CMR accurately quantify myocardial blood flow and reserve compared to perfusion-derived measures?
AI-enhanced exercise CMR offers a feasible, needle-free approach to quantify global myocardial perfusion and coronary flow reserve without requiring pharmacologic stress.
We demonstrate the feasibility of a high-resolution, high-frame-rate CMR technique for quantifying post-exercise CS flow and CFR, with excellent repeatability and good agreement with perfusion-derived measures. This approach shows promise for assessing global myocardial perfusion after physiological exercise without pharmacologic stress, warranting further validation.
